
Double-Stranded RNA viruses are known as.
A. Arboviruses
B. Riboviruses
C. Reoviruses
D. Ribovira.
Answer
563.4k+ views
Hint: All living organisms possess a genome that is called genetic material which is either DNA or RNA and single-stranded or double-stranded. The genetic material presents naked or enclosed in the nuclear membrane. usually enclosed genetic material found in eukaryotes and naked found in prokaryotes.
Complete answer: Virus are the microscopic entity which acts as living when it is present in the host cell and acts as nonliving when it is present outside the host cell. Double-stranded RNA viruses are polyphyletic virus groups that have a double-stranded genome which transcribes positive strands of RNA. Double-stranded RNA viruses are classified into two phyla duplornaviricota and pisuviricota and also consist of rotavirus which causes gastroenteritis in the young child which is a globally known disease. The double-stranded RNA virus is Reovirus, any group of ribonucleic acid consisting of the family reoviridae which is a small group of animal and plant viruses. The virions of reoviruses appear spheroid and have two icosahedral capsids and possess double-stranded RNA which lack an outer envelope.
Arbovirus term used for the group of the virus which are transmitted by arthropods animal which acts as a vector, the double-stranded RNA is not known, the symptoms of arbovirus occur 315 days after being infected by the virus and last 3 to 4 days. Riboviruses are viruses, which possess single and double-stranded RNA as the genome, while ribovira also contain either RNA or DNA genome.
Hence, the correct option is C.
